Athletistic / Football. Norrköping striker Emil Roebuck, who belongs to Italian Milan, has disappeared in Sweden.
According to Corriere della Sera, the 20-year-old footballer has not been in contact for 14 days. Norrköping representatives and the player’s family do not know what happened to Emil. Roebuck did not show up for club training for two weeks and did not notify anyone of his possible absence.
The source claims that Norrköping’s sports director tried to contact Roebak, but never managed to contact him. Currently, information about the disappearance of the footballer is spreading in the Swedish media.
Emil Robak graduated from Swedish Hammarby. The striker has been in the Milan system since September 2020. The Rossoneri paid 1.5 million euros for his transfer. The striker’s rental contract with the Swedish club runs until November 30, 2023. The Transfermarkt portal estimates his market value at 200 thousand euros.
